 Hello All,
 I am working on summer project. And i came to know about QGIS before 3
 months, My project is to convert raster or vector format in 3D view. And i
 need to develop a plugin to do so. I have created plugin which displays
 shapefile in QGIS (It was just a sample). I have created 2,3 sample plugins
 with PyQt.

 In my company 1 scientist suggested me to use GRASS for 3d. In GRASS there
 are simple options like 2D, 3D and digitizer. Grass plugin is given in QGIS
 but i am having difficulty to use it. I am using QGIS 1.0.2 Core and GRASS
 6.5 SVN. I am working on windows. Even i am about to download latest version
 of QGIS. Because 1.0.2 is very old, May be thtas why i am facing some
 difficulty in GRASS. In GRASS for vector it says G_getenv(): Variable
 GISBase not set, and in raster it says not recognized format. And same data
 i use in GRASS GIS very easily. I have lesst time left. I have to submit my
 project by 15th April. Can anyone help me what can i use for converting into
 3D?

I'm trying to find a way to change not just the units that the measurement
tool uses in a project, but also to change the units used by the scale bar.

For example, my raster data that I'm using is UTM, so is using meters, but
I'd like the displayed units in the scale bar to be feet.  Is this possible?
